The Hanoitimes - However, as South Korean passengers have now cancelled air bookings to Vietnam, airlines are reducing flight frequency to South Korea. Despite the complicated situation of Covid-19 outbreak in South Korea, the Vietnamese Ministry of Transport (MoT) has not considered suspending flights between Vietnam and South Korea, according to Le Anh Tuan, vice minister of transport. Illustrative photo. However, as a large number of South Korean passengers have cancelled air bookings to Vietnam, airlines are reducing flight frequency to South Korea, said Tuan in an interview with Vietnam News Agency on February 23. Without passengers, most airlines have suspended flight routes from Vietnam to Daegu, the epicenter of the outbreak, while only Vietjet Air flies to Daegu at the moment, Tuan added. Vietnam’s first airline suspends flights to S.Korea
The Hanoitimes - As of present, four Vietnamese airlines are operating 14 flight routes to South Korean’s major cities. Bamboo Airways has become Vietnam’s first airline to suspend flights to South Korea due to the rapid spread of the Covid-19 epidemic in the Northeast Asian country. In a bid to ensure safety for passengers and the community, the airline would suspend the operation of two routes Da Nang – Incheon (DAD-ICN) and Nha Trang – Incheon (CXR-ICN) from February 26, said Bamboo Airways in a statement. Currently, DAD-ICN and CXR – ICN routes are being operated daily by Bamboo Airways with a frequency of seven two-way flights per week each with A321NEO. “The operation suspension of these two routes is an extremely important and necessary action to actively contribute to preventing the spread of epidemic,” said the airline. Hanoi to quarantine people from South Korea’s coronavirus-hit regions
The Hanoitimes - The Hanoi’s authorities will have to plan quarantine and monitor Vietnamese returning from South Korea. Hanoi would isolate people from South Korea’s regions infected with Covid-19 epidemic for 14 days from the day of their arrival in the capital city, Zing.vn quoted Deputy Director of the municipal Department of Health Hoang Duc Hanh as saying at a meeting on February 23. Photo: Zing According to Hanh, there are about 26,000 Vietnamese citizens living in Deagu and North Gyeongsang, the two South Korea’s provinces where Covid-19 broke out, and asked the Epidemic Prevention Steering Committee to set plan for quarantining the returnees from there. Hanh requested isolatation of South Korean tourists coming from these two provinces for 14 days at their accommodation facilities. Vietnam to apply preventive safety measures on passengers from South Korea
The Hanoitimes - Health declaration is now required for everyone coming to Vietnam from South Korea. Vietnam started to apply preventive safety measures to all passengers from South Korea as of 3:00pm on February 23 at all border gates, according to the Ministry of Health. Due to the complicated evolution of the Covid-19 epidemic in South Korea, Vietnam’s Ministry of Health on Sunday held a meeting with relevant ministries and agencies to analyze the situation in South Korea and proposed measures to prevent the disease from spreading through arrivals from the Northeast Asian country. Illustrative photo Health declaration is now required for everyone coming from South Korea, according to a Health Ministry regulation issued yesterday. Those with symptoms like high fever, coughing and breathing difficulties will be put in quarantine. Vietnam aviation industry to see US$1 billion revenue shaved on Covid-19
The Hanoitimes - Northeast Asian markets such as China, Japan, Taiwan and South Korea make up a significant source of revenue for Vietnamese airlines. The Civil Aviation Authority of Vietnam (CAAV) has estimated the Covid-19 epidemic would cause a decline of 15% year-on-year in the number of air passengers and a loss of VND25 trillion (US$1.08 billion) in revenue to local airlines, VnExpress reported. At a meeting on February 27, CAAV Director Dinh Viet Thang said the agency has envisioned two scenarios for Vietnam’s aviation market in 2020 under the impact of the Covid-19 epidemic. In the first scenario where the epidemic is contained before April, airlines in Vietnam would handle a total of 67 million passengers, down 15% year-on-year, including 32 million foreign and 35 million domestic passengers.
